Timeline

The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.

  • 2020-06-09 Effective date: 02/01/2021.
  • 2020-06-09 Signed by the Governor. Becomes Act No. 128. executive-signature
  • 2020-06-01 Sent to the Governor for executive approval. executive-receipt
  • 2020-05-31 Signed by the President of the Senate.
  • 2020-05-27 Enrolled and signed by the Speaker of the House.
  • 2020-05-27 Received from the Senate without amendments.
  • 2020-05-26 Read by title, passed by a vote of 34 yeas and 0 nays, and ordered returned to the House. Motion to reconsider tabled. passage
  • 2020-05-21 Reported without Legislative Bureau amendments. Read by title and passed to third reading and final passage.
  • 2020-05-20 Reported favorably. Rules suspended. Read by title and referred to the Legislative Bureau.
  • 2020-05-18 Read second time by title and referred to the Committee on Senate and Governmental Affairs. referral-committee
  • 2020-05-15 Received in the Senate. Rules suspended. Read first time by title and placed on the Calendar for a second reading.
  • 2020-05-15 Read third time by title, roll called on final passage, yeas 95, nays 0. Finally passed, title adopted, ordered to the Senate. passage
  • 2020-05-13 Scheduled for floor debate on 05/15/20.
  • 2020-05-13 Read by title, ordered engrossed, passed to 3rd reading.
  • 2020-05-07 Reported favorably (14-0).
  • 2020-03-09 Read by title, under the rules, referred to the Committee on House and Governmental Affairs. referral-committee
  • 2020-02-24 First appeared in the Interim Calendar on 2/24/2020.
  • 2020-02-19 Under the rules, provisionally referred to the Committee on House and Governmental Affairs. referral-committee
  • 2020-02-19 Prefiled. filing
